“Children should not be used as pawns in a bid to punish your ex” – BBNaija Ifu Ennada calls for support for Do2dtun over custody battle with ex-wife and family

Big Brother Naija’s former housemate, Ifu Ennada has weighed into the ongoing custody battle between On Air Personality, Oladotun Ojuolape better known as Do2dtun, and his ex-wife, Omotayo Oyebanjo.

Over the weekend, the media personality in a series on his Instagram page dragged the younger sister of singer, D’banj for denying him access to his daughters.

Calling for support for him, Ifu stated that netizens should make this trend and shouldn’t wait until things get very ugly before it trends.

She noted how Dotun has every right to see his children as she noted how there is a court order in support of this.

The reality star described his situation as heartbreaking as she further noted how badly people have treated him.

Taking a dig at his in-laws who are in support of their daughter’s action, she questioned their spiritual life.

Ifu added that no matter the cause of a break-up, children shouldn’t be used as pawns in a bid to punish your ex, especially one that really wants to be in their lives.
